Description:
Associate Professor
Minimum Requirements:
- A PhD / Doctorate qualification in Chemical Engineering
- A Degree in Chemical Engineering (e.g, BTech, BEng, BScEng, Advanced Diploma, MTech, MSc, or MEng).
- At least 7 years of teaching experience / professional experience.
- A minimum of seven DHET-accredited publications or creative outputs over the preceding three years.
- Successful postgraduate supervision of at least two Master’s students and one Doctorate student.
- The standard achieved in each of the abovementioned must be of a high level.
- Recipient of grant awards
- Good communication and lecturing skills.
- A strong passion for teaching and research.
- Evidence of leadership in community organizations and participation in activities in the wider community relating specifically to the academic discipline of the candidate and/or involvement in significant activities in professional, cultural, religious, sporting, development, and other fields.
- Bibliometrics to evaluate the quality of research output.
- Registrable as a professional engineer or engineering technologist with the Engineering Council of South Africa (ECSA).
Summary of Duties:
- Teach Chemical Engineering subjects at both undergraduate and postgraduate levels.
- Supervision of postgraduate projects and postgraduate students.
- Development of learning materials for different courses.
- Actively involved in research and research activities.
- Active participation in industrial projects.
- Knowledge of online learning software, g. Moodle, Blackboard, Teams.
- Participation in community engagement projects.
- Assist with administrative duties as delegated.
- Any other duties as prescribed by the Head of Department.
- Registered or qualifies for registration with the Engineering Council of South Africa (ECSA).
Additional requirements
- Exceptional knowledge of his or her subject matter/discipline.
- Excellent classroom and tutorial performance.
- Effective utilization of innovative teaching and assessment methods.
- Very good communication and human relations skills.
- Excellent performance as an academic advisor who encourages active learning among students.
- Effective design and development of curriculum.
- Papers presented at subject conferences (nationally or internationally).
- Examination of postgraduate students and other indications of peer-reviewed activities.
- Management of research projects/programs.
- Recognition by professional and industrial communities.
- Initiation of high-level courses, development of education methodology, advanced seminars, etc.
- Proven achievement in professional research, creative activities, scholarly writings, and participation in professional activities.
